#869646 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#869646 is composed of 52.5% red, 58.8%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 72 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 43.1%. #869646 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#0d2d00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#869646 color description : Dark moderate yellow.

#869646 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#869646 has RGB values of R:134, G:150,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 8820294.

Shades and Tints of #869646

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#f9faf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#869646

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727468 is the less saturated color, while #afda02 is the most saturated one.
